The temperature soared to a blistering 102° at O’Hare, Midway and Northerly Island yesterday and according to Chief Meteorologist Tom Skilling of WGN-TV, this marked only the second time in 142 years where a reading of 100+ has been recorded on Independence Day. Yesterday’s high tied the record for hottest July 4th, last reached over a century ago. The […]
